How Much Does Window Installation Cost In Potsdam?
Window installation and replacement costs will be influenced by several factors, including how difficult your windows are to access or install, the materials you choose, and the number and size of the windows. On average, Potsdam homeowners should expect to spend about $290 per window*. Below are additional cost breakdowns. *Cost data based on sample pricing for window installation from multiple retailers and adjusted for local cost of living.
When To Replace Windows
New, energy-efficient windows can greatly boost your home's comfort, insulation, noise reduction, value, and appearance. Obvious signs that it's time for window replacement include the following:
- High energy bills and discomfort due to poor insulation.
- Outdated and inefficient window styles that take away from your house's curb appeal.
- Fogging between window panes, condensation issues, or rotting window frames that allow moisture intrusion into the home.
- Windows that are hard to open, close, or lock properly due to age and wear.
- Drafts and cold air coming in from old, loose-fitting windows.
How To Choose a Window Company
Picking a window installer with appropriate qualifications helps ensure a smooth installation. We review the most important qualities to consider when selecting a qualified provider below.
Experience
Look for well-established local companies with a long track record of experience successfully installing all types of windows. These providers are more likely to have a deep knowledge of Potsdam's climate and local homeowner needs. Ask for references from recent clients to confirm the quality of a company's work.
Certifications
Look for installers that are backed by top window manufacturers and accredited by top industry associations, including the Fenestration and Glazing Industry Alliance, formerly known as the AAMA. Appropriate credentials mean that a provider has gotten proper training in quality installation methods. Ensure installers are employees, not subcontractors. Verify that any technicians assigned to your job have the right certifications.
Reputation
Read through online feedback from past clients, check the Better Business Bureau (BBB), and request local references. Review customer feedback to make sure that the company consistently provides quality work and good customer service. Avoid contractors that have complaints of shoddy work or unfinished jobs.
Process
The best company will take time to provide you with a detailed project plan, timeline, expectations, and reviews of all material and installation options. Beware of unclear quotes or timelines that don't provide enough specifics upfront. Look for continual communication throughout the process to avoid surprises later on.
Warranties
Look for window installers that back their installations with guarantees, and that provide warranties on materials and labor. This demonstrates confidence in their work. Also seek out unlimited lifetime warranties that can be transferred to new homeowners.
Materials
Make sure the window company offers windows that are built to last and top energy-saving window brands that fit your budget. Look for good energy ratings, design flexibility, and enhanced UV protection. Check that the window materials also include manufacturer warranties.
